C
Teleflex Incorporated TFX
$204.70 $4.252.12%
Recommendation
Prev Close
Volume
Avg Vol (90D)
Market Cap
Dividend & Yield
52-Week Range
P/E (TTM)
EPS (TTM)

03/31/2024 12/31/2023 10/01/2023 07/02/2023 04/02/2023
Revenue 4.93% 6.57% 5.85% 3.22% 1.52%
Total Other Revenue -- -- -- -- --
Total Revenue 4.93% 6.57% 5.85% 3.22% 1.52%
Cost of Revenue 3.59% 5.40% 4.31% 2.98% 1.18%
Gross Profit 6.03% 7.53% 7.13% 3.43% 1.81%
SG&A Expenses 25.45% 11.89% 4.15% 4.27% 2.64%
Depreciation & Amortization -- -- -- -- --
Other Operating Expenses -- -- -- -- --
Total Operating Expenses 11.30% 7.52% 4.60% 4.19% 2.62%
Operating Income -22.96% 2.42% 11.31% -0.78% -3.01%
Income Before Tax -30.96% -2.67% 0.77% -23.18% -20.42%
Income Tax Expenses -83.14% -7.91% 16.94% 5.56% 11.96%
Earnings from Continuing Operations -18.42% -1.47% -1.88% -27.69% -25.59%
Earnings from Discontinued Operations -1,059.60% -657.85% -290.08% -708.33% -430.00%
Extraordinary Item & Accounting Change -- -- -- -- --
Minority Interest in Earnings -- -- -- -- --
Net Income -18.71% -1.88% -2.14% -27.72% -25.61%
EBIT -22.96% 2.42% 11.31% -0.78% -3.01%
EBITDA -13.90% 3.22% 8.89% -0.01% -2.53%
EPS Basic -18.85% -2.04% -2.31% -27.86% -25.76%
Normalized Basic EPS -29.24% -1.55% 7.58% -5.23% -5.70%
EPS Diluted -18.80% -1.96% -2.21% -27.57% -25.42%
Normalized Diluted EPS -29.17% -1.38% 7.92% -4.80% -5.21%
Average Basic Shares Outstanding 0.20% 0.18% 0.16% 0.16% 0.21%
Average Diluted Shares Outstanding 0.11% -0.01% -0.15% -0.27% -0.31%
Dividend Per Share 0.00% 0.00% 0.00% 0.00% 0.00%
Payout Ratio 0.23% 0.02% 0.02% 0.39% 0.35%
Weiss Ratings